API removals or changes: PVP suggests a major version bump
API changes (from Hackage documentation)
- Network.IPFS.Config: get :: (MonadReader cfg m, Has a cfg) => m a
- Network.IPFS.Internal.Constraint: type MonadRIO cfg m = (MonadIO m, MonadReader cfg m)
- Network.IPFS.Internal.Orphanage.ByteString.Lazy: instance Data.Aeson.Types.FromJSON.FromJSON Data.ByteString.Internal.ByteString
+ Network.IPFS.Internal.Orphanage.ByteString.Lazy: instance Data.Aeson.Types.FromJSON.FromJSON Data.ByteString.Lazy.Internal.ByteString
- Network.IPFS: class Monad m => MonadRemoteIPFS m
+ Network.IPFS: class MonadIO m => MonadRemoteIPFS m
- Network.IPFS.Pin: add :: (MonadRIO cfg m, MonadRemoteIPFS m, MonadLogger m) => CID -> m (Either Error CID)
+ Network.IPFS.Pin: add :: (MonadRemoteIPFS m, MonadLogger m) => CID -> m (Either Error CID)
- Network.IPFS.Pin: rm :: (MonadRIO cfg m, MonadRemoteIPFS m, MonadLogger m) => CID -> m (Either Error CID)
+ Network.IPFS.Pin: rm :: (MonadRemoteIPFS m, MonadLogger m) => CID -> m (Either Error CID)
- Network.IPFS.Process: runProc :: (MonadRIO cfg m, HasProcessContext cfg, HasLogFunc cfg) => (ProcessConfig stdin stdout () -> m a) -> FilePath -> StreamIn stdin -> StreamOut stdout -> [Opt] -> m a
+ Network.IPFS.Process: runProc :: (MonadIO m, MonadReader cfg m, HasProcessContext cfg, HasLogFunc cfg) => (ProcessConfig stdin stdout () -> m a) -> FilePath -> StreamIn stdin -> StreamOut stdout -> [Opt] -> m a
- Network.IPFS.Remote.Class: class Monad m => MonadRemoteIPFS m
+ Network.IPFS.Remote.Class: class MonadIO m => MonadRemoteIPFS m
